| Detail | Information |
|---|---|
| Full Name | Kelly Cates (née Dalglish) |
| Date of Birth | September 1975 |
| Place of Birth | Glasgow, Scotland |
| Age (2026) | 50 |
| Nationality | British (Scottish) |
| Parents | Sir Kenny Dalglish & Marina, Lady Dalglish |
| Siblings | Paul Dalglish, Lauren Dalglish, Lynsey Dalglish Robinson |
| Children | Two daughters |
| Former Spouse | Tom Cates (married 2007, separated 2021) |
| Education | University of Glasgow (Mathematics, left 1998) |
| Occupation | Sports broadcaster, television presenter, radio host |
| Current Employer(s) | BBC (Match of the Day), Sky Sports, BBC Radio 5 Live |
| Career Start | 1998 (Sky Sports News launch presenter) |
| Notable Role | Co-host, Match of the Day (from 2025, replacing Gary Lineker) |
| Award | Presenter of the Year, Sports Journalists’ Association (2024) |

It’s also noteworthy that the public’s attention to her appearance coincided with her most prominent professional moment. It’s not easy to become a co-host of Match of the Day. It places her in front of millions of viewers every week, subjecting her to a degree of scrutiny that, despite his cultural prominence, Gary Lineker never experienced in quite the same gendered manner. Along with Mark Chapman and Gabby Logan, her appointment was historic in its own subtle way.
In the 60-year history of the program, she was among the first women to occupy the position.
